Transaction

27eaf3e6484a9708cfbef8ffa993c22c68a9f7bfa5de021309bc6b04f99e8e6a
252,429 confirmations
Timestamp
1622900162
Block686,377
Fee6,554 sats
Fee rate29 sats/vB
view on mempool.space

Inputs & Outputs